\textit{J. Garloff} [J. Comput. Appl. Math. 14, 353-360 (1986; Zbl 0593.65022)] stated a theorem on the boundedness of the sequence \(\{k^{- \alpha}[A]^ k\}^{\infty}_{k=1}\), where [A] is an \(n\times n\) interval matrix with powers \([A]^ k:=[A]^{k-1}\cdot [A]\) and where \(\alpha\geq 0\). In the present paper, this theorem is proved in a different way. Furthermore, criteria are derived guaranteeing that the sequence \(\{\| k^{-\alpha}|\) \([A]^ k| \|^{1/k}\}^{\infty}_{k=1}\) (\(|.|\) absolute value, \(\|.\|\) any monotone matrix norm) converges to the spectral radius of \(| [A]|\).
